Kamaraj College Courses and Fees 2026
| Degree | Duration | Annual Fee | Seats | Eligibility | Action |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Master of Computer Applications1 Specialization | 3 Years | NA | NA | NA | Apply Now |
Bachelor of Science7 Specializations | 3 Years | ₹759 | NA | 10+2 | Apply Now |
Master of Science4 Specializations | 2 Years | ₹654 | NA | Graduation | Apply Now |
Bachelor of Arts2 Specializations | 3 Years | ₹269 | NA | 10+2 | Apply Now |
Bachelor of Commerce3 Specializations | 3 Years | ₹259 | NA | 10+2 | Apply Now |
Bachelor of Computer Applications1 Specialization | 3 Years | NA | NA | 10+2 | Apply Now |
Kamaraj College Rankings
Rankings
| Year | Rank Publisher | Ranking |
|---|---|---|
| 2025 | NIRF | 101-150 out of 300 · Overall |
| 2024 | NIRF | 101-150 out of 300 · Overall |
